A little smudgy but good for triplicates
My store still uses carbon paper for our hand written receipts. Pelikan is the best but it is very expensive now. Kores is also good, Tina quality is decent. The kores however is stickier and we have to peel it off the invoice paper each time. Tina is a little cleaner in this aspect. But Tina is good for single copies, about 30x. For triplicates the writing does not transfer through dark enough unless you really press down hard on the pen.Kores can handle triplicates for at least 50x, however after about 20x the carbon starts to smudge and the writing does not transfer as sharply as fresh new sheets. Also smudges ink onto the hands
